Description
We are creating a Butterfly Waystation and restoring The Greenbay Trail in Glencoe between Harbor and Scott Street. Most of the Buckthorn has been cut -and we have collected and cleaned native seeds. We are still in the process of cleaning up old excess wood that has built up over the years. In the spring we will be working to clean up the Garlic Mustard.
